Quote:
Originally posted by Ruatha:
quote:
Originally posted by Suicide Junkie:

If you cranked your maint. redux. to +20% (the maximum effective amount), you will pay only 1/5th of the normal maintenance costs (5% of build price per turn)
20 % maintenance reduction decreases maintenance cost by 80%????
It sure does:

25%-20% = 5% / 25% = 20%

A savings of 80% per ship. Nice isn't it?

Default Re: Emergency Build problem

In the latest P&N PBW Versions, I have fixed it, so that a reduction of +20% leaves you with 80% of normal maintenance.

In unmodded SE4, however, maintenance reduction is the uber-trait.

Default Re: Emergency Build problem

If you are ahead on tech, you can probably also boost your resource output significantly by using monoliths.

On any planet where the lower two resource values combined are at least half of the majority resource, replace production facilities one by one with monoliths.

Build a resource converter on one planet in your empire, to convert the stuff to whatever you need.

You'll end up making at least as many minerals as you currently do, but you will also be making just as many organics and rads.

Convert the extra organics and rads to minerals by using the converter, and you suddenly have more than twice as much money rolling around your pockets.
Which equates to twice as many ships

Quote:
Originally posted by Suicide Junkie:
Build a resource converter on one planet in your empire, to convert the stuff to whatever you need.
But you need a converter in more than one system right?
I mean taht the converter is a system facility, not empire facility. It only converts resources made in the system it resides in.
